Файлообменник

Файлообменная сеть — это общий доступ к компьютерных данных или пространства в сети с разными уровнями. Несмотря на то что файлами можно легко обмениваться вне сети (например, просто передавая или отправляя их на физических носителях), вышеуказанный термин почти всегда означает совместное сетевое использование, даже если это происходит в небольшой локальной сети.

Файлообменная сеть: типы и принцип работы. Бесплатный файлообменник

Что они собой представляют?

Файлообменные сети позволяют нескольким людям использовать один и тот же файл при помощи некоторой комбинации возможностей чтения, записи или изменения, копирования или печати. Как правило, такая сеть имеет одну http://vkmsk.ru/ или несколько администраторов. Пользователи могут иметь одинаковые или различные уровни доступа. Обмен файлами также может означать наличие выделенного количества личного хранилища данных в общей файловой системе.

В течение многих лет файлообменная сеть представляла собой функцию многоэлементных и многопользовательских компьютерных систем. С появлением интернета широко используется система, называемая протоколом передачи файлов (FTP).

Файлообменная сеть: типы и принцип работы. Бесплатный файлообменник

Самый известный пример

FTP может использоваться для чтения и, возможно, записи файлов, общие для определенного набора пользователей сайта FTP-сервера, с доступом по паролю. Многие FTP-сайты предлагают общий доступ к файлам или, по крайней мере, возможность просматривать или копировать данные, загружать их, используя общедоступный пароль (который является «анонимным»). Большинство разработчиков веб-сайтов используют файлообменник для загрузки новых или пересмотренных файлов на сервер. Более того, сама Всемирная паутина может рассматриваться как крупномасштабная файлообменная сеть, в которой запрашиваемые страницы или файлы постоянно загружаются или копируются пользователями. Обмен файлами — это практика совместного использования или предоставления доступа к цифровой информации или ресурсов, включая документы, мультимедиа (аудио/видео), графические, компьютерные программы, изображения, электронные книги. Это частное или публичное распространение данных и ресурсов в сети с различными уровнями привилегий на совместное использование. Еще одним примером такой системы можно назвать бесплатные файлообменники, которые позволяют передавать и получать данные для пользователей сети.

Виды файлообменных сетей

Обмен файлами можно выполнить несколькими способами. Наиболее распространенные методы их хранения, распространения и передачи включают в себя следующее:

  • Съемные устройства хранения данных.
  • Централизованные установки сервера (файлового хостинга в сетях).
  • Веб-ориентированные гиперссылки.
  • Распределенные одноранговые сети.

Как обеспечивается функциональность?

В большинстве задач файлообменной сети используются два основных набора сетевых критериев: Peer-to-Peer (P2P), файлообменная сеть Узлы или общий доступ к файлам: это самый популярный способ совместного использования данных, который обеспечивается за счет специального программного обеспечения. Пользователи сетевого компьютера определяют общие данные с помощью стороннего программного обеспечения. Обмен файлами в P2P позволяет пользователям напрямую просматривать, загружать и редактировать данные. Некоторое стороннее программное обеспечение облегчает обмен P2P путем сбора и сегментации больших файлов на более мелкие части (например, Ares).

Файлообменная сеть: типы и принцип работы. Бесплатный файлообменник

Файлообменная сеть как услуги хостинга файлов: эта альтернатива предоставляет широкий выбор популярных онлайн-материалов. Эти службы достаточно часто используются с методами совместной работы в Интернете, включая электронную почту, блоги, форумы или другие среды, в которые могут быть включены прямые ссылки на скачивание службы хостинга файлов. На этих веб-сайтах обычно размещаются файлы, позволяющие пользователям скачивать их. Когда пользователи загружают или используют файл с помощью сети обмена, их компьютер становится частью этой системы, позволяя другим людям загружать данные со своего компьютера. На этом принципе основаны многие бесплатные файлообменники. Однако такой обмен данными, как правило, является незаконным, за исключением совместного использования материалов, которые не защищены авторским правом или являются собственностью.

Файлообменная сеть: типы и принцип работы. Бесплатный файлообменник

Еще одна проблема с файлообменными приложениями — проблема шпионского или рекламного ПО, поскольку некоторые сайты обмена файлами размещают программы-шпионы на своих страницах. Эти шпионские программы часто устанавливаются на компьютеры пользователей без их согласия и осведомленности.

Службы синхронизации файлов и общего доступа

Службы синхронизации и совместного использования файлов на основе облака реализуют их автоматическую передачу путем обновления файлов из выбранного каталога общего доступа на сетевых устройствах каждого пользователя. Данные, размещенные в этой папке, также могут быть просмотрены и загружены через веб-сайт и мобильное приложение и могут быть доступны другим пользователям для просмотра или совместной работы. Такие услуги стали популярными благодаря ориентированного на потребителя предоставление услуг файлообменных сетей, в частности, Dropbox и GoogleDrive. Rsync — более традиционная программа, выпущенная в 1996 году, которая синхронизирует файлы на прямой машинной основе.Синхронизация данных в целом может использовать другие подходы к обмену данными. В качестве характерных примеров можно привести распределенные файловые системы, контроль версий или зеркала.

История развития файлообменных сетей

Сначала файлы обменивались с помощью съемных носителей. Компьютеры смогли получать доступ к удаленным данным с помощью установки файловой системы, систем досок объявлений (1978), Usenet (1979) и FTP-серверов (1985). Возникли позже InternetRelayChat (1988) и Hotline (1997) позволили пользователям общаться удаленно через чат и обмениваться файлами. В конце 1990-х годов широкое распространение получила кодирования mp3 которая была стандартизирована в 1991 году и существенно уменьшала размер аудиофайлов.
В июне 1999 года был разработан Napster как неструктурированная централизованная одноранговая система, что требует сервера для индексирования и выявление других участников соединения. Gnutella, eDonkey2000 и Freenet были выпущены в 2000 году и сразу широко распространились по многим странам. Так, Gnutella была первой децентрализованной сетью обмена файлами. В этой сети все соединительные программы считались равными, и поэтому она не имела центральной точки отказа. Freenet стала первой сетью, что гарантирует анонимность. Затем было выпущено клиентское и серверное программное обеспечение eDonkey2000 которое стало прообразом популярных сегодня торрентов. В 2001 году были выпущены Kazaa и Poisoned для Mac. Их сеть FastTrack была распределена лучше, хотя, в отличие от Gnutella, она несла в себе больше трафика, чтобы повысить эффективность маршрутизации. Сеть была проприетарной и зашифрованы, и разработчики Kazaa в результате выиграли конкуренцию.